    1. AOL blocking e-mails
    2. AOL has recently started blocking the sending of eMails that have more than a certain number of eMail addresses within that eMail. I use AOL 5.0 and because, from time-to-time, it has been necessary to reinstall AOL 5.0 and this entails creating a new address book, I protected the eMail addresses in my address book by placing all the eMail addresses (about 250 or so) into an eMail and sending this eMail to several Internet-based eMail accounts that I created, as well as saving this eMail with all the eMail addressees as a WORD document. Then, without any notice, this past weekend, when I attempted to send this eMail with 250 or so eMail addresses inside this eMail to my Internet-based eMail accounts, AOL would not allow it to be sent because this eMail was "Rate Limited". I could send other eMails, but not this particular eMail that included all the eMail addresses in my eMail address book. Regards, Walter Greenspan Great Falls, MT & Jericho, NY
